Mr. and Mrs. Geoff Iles and Mr. and Mrs. Chad A. Huber, all of Natchez, announce the engagement of their daughter, Mary Catherine Iles to Chip Huntsberry, son of Col. Gail Gerding of Bradenton, Fla.

The bride-to-be is a graduate of Trinity Episcopal Day School in Natchez and a graduate of Louisiana State University in Baton Rouge. She is employed by communications marketing firm, Edelman, in Atlanta.

She is the granddaughter of Mrs. Judith Williams and the late Mr. Arthur M. Williams III, of West Monroe, La., Mrs. Betty Iles and the late Dr. Jerry Iles, Mr. and Mrs. David Huber and Ms. Nancy Hungerford, all of Natchez.

The groom-to-be is a graduate of Georgetown High School in Georgetown, Texas. He enlisted in the U.S. Marine Corps, serving four years with a tour in Iraq and Afghanistan. He is a graduate of Georgia State University in Atlanta and a logistics manager for an Atlanta-based company.

He is the grandson of the late Dr. and Mrs. Thomas G. Gerding of Georgetown and the late Mr. and Mrs. Harry J. Huntsberry of Fort Worth, Texas.

The wedding will be 6:30 p.m., Saturday, April 28, 2018, at Dunleith Historic Inn in Natchez.

A reception will immediately follow the ceremony.
